Calcified Tissue International and Musculoskeletal Research is among the leading peer-reviewed journals publishing original preclinical, translational, and clinical research as well as expert reviews in the bone and musculoskeletal field.

Journal Editors, Professor René Rizzoli and Professor Stuart Ralston are delighted to announce the top 10 most impactful papers of 2019, as cited in 2019/2020. The authors of each of these outstanding papers have been recognized with certificates of publishing excellence.

Thanking the authors for their contributions, the editors remarked:

"Calcified Tissue International strives to publish the best of new research and notable reviews in the bone and muscle field. Accordingly, our focus on high quality publications has been reflected in an increasing journal citation impact factor."
